Nigeria’s National Development Plan (2021–2025) identifies the protection of women’s maternal health as a key driver of national development. Central to the plan is the goal of reducing maternal mortality from 512 deaths to 300 deaths per 100,000 live births by 2025, while also tackling malnutrition among women of reproductive age.
